#e3bc28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3bc28 is composed of 89% red, 73.7%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 47.5 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 52.4%. #e3bc28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#c77900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#e3bc28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3bc28 has RGB values of R:227, G:188,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.82,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14924840.

Shades and Tints of #e3bc28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3bc28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868685 is the less saturated color, while #f6c715 is the most saturated one.
